Airport Warehouse Agent

4 months ago


Dorval QC, Canada GAT Airline Ground Support Full time
Summary
• Warehouse Agents are responsible for building all galleys to the clients' specifications for all scheduled flights. This position requires working in a fast-paced environment with time constraints to meet arrival and departure goals. A professional and positive image must be consistently displayed by the employee. "Lead by Example" concept is strongly promoted.
• Warehouse Agents must report to work on a regular and timely basis and report directly to the supervisor and/or manager on duty.

Job Duties
• Build/strip commissary according to airline specs and schedules within established timelines
• Actively participates in the Safety Management System (SMS)
• Complete inventories according to airline requirements
• Understand and comply with Canada Border Services Agency Memorandum D7-1-1 & D4-1-4
• Understand and comply with Transport Canada requirements
• Understand and comply with IATA Food Safety requirements
• Actively participate in Sky Café's Safety Management System (SMS) including reporting hazard and incidents encountered in daily operations. Understand, comply with and promote the company Safety Policy
• Responsible for maintaining safety and security of the warehouse at all times
• Assist in set up, cleaning and storage of equipment & warehouse
• Responsible for courteous, prompt, accurate and careful handling of food and goods, including loading and offloading
• Receive, perform temperature testing and inspection of catering deliveries from our food service provider
• Operate forklift while observing safe procedures and maintenance of equipment, including the performance of equipment checks
• Comply with all Sky Café and airline policies
• Constantly communicate with other catering personnel, and respective airline communication centers if applicable
• Performs other duties as required

Requirements
• Be at least 18 years of age
• Ability to work on a permanent basis in Canada
• Obtain a clear criminal record
• Ability to obtain necessary airport and/or Transport Canada security clearances
• Must be capable of lifting/pushing/pulling up to 70lbs on a regular basis
• Ability to work within the required time parameters
• Ability to work nights, weekends, holidays and varying schedules
• Must successfully complete airline and corporate specific training programs and recertification

Core Competencies
• Able to work efficiently as a part of a team as well as independently
• Operate Equipment in a safe and respectful manner
• Able to work well under pressure and meet set deadlines
• Attention to detail in all areas of work
• Strong work ethic and positive team attitude
Wage: $18.00/hour, after 3 months $18.50/hour
